Aer Lingus announce Dublin Airport to Montreal & Minneapolis Route

Aer Lingus

Aer Lingus have announced two new direct flights from Dublin airport, which will begin mid 2019. The airline, which last year reported a 15% rise in profits, have confirmed that they will be flying direct from the Irish hub to Montreal and Minneapolis–Saint Paul from next summer. Dublin Airport Hub – The Forecast

Dublin airport-terminal2

As Aer Lingus announce two new North American routes from Dublin Airport, an economic report has predicted that the continued development of the airport as a Hub could add €18.6bn to Ireland’s GDP over the next 15 years. Report: 45 % of business travellers view terrorism as their greatest safety risk

business travel cut costs

Keeping staff safe when they are travelling for work has become an ever important task for companies. GBTA has released research which found that 45% of business travellers view terrorism as their greatest safety risk. Accor Hotels Make Food Waste Pledge

accor hotels

Accor Hotels have pledged to reduce food waste by 30% over the next two years. The hotel chain are responding to ever increasing pressure from travellers and customers to become more environmentally friendly and less wasteful.
